Hello, I recall reading an article about Intel having new branding by adding a "+" symbol behinds CPUs. For example, Core i9+, i7+. etc. I think these CPUs add some kind of Optane memory.

How come I cannot find i9-7900X+ in store yet?

Because it is literally brand new.
And all it does is include the optane module in the box. It's not part of the CPU.
Nothing special.
